1.Carcinoma of the axillary breast.
Jae Ho CHEONG ; Byung Chan LEE ; Kyong Sik LEE
Yonsei Medical Journal 1999;40(3):290-293
Axillary breast is one of the varieties of polymastia which is characterized by the presence of more than 2 breasts. It may cause symptoms during pregnancy, lactation, or in the premenopausal period. Unless there are obvious symptoms of lactation or the assistance of further imaging studies such as mammography and breast ultrasound, the diagnosis is often confused with subcutaneous lipoma. The incidence of axillary breast cancer is low but it should be investigated and treated properly in view of another breast cancer in the embryonic milk-line. In this paper we reviewed 4 cases of axillary breast cancer and documented some articles regarding aberrant breast and carcinoma arising from it. It is suggested that subcutaneous nodules of uncertain origin around the periphery of the breast should be viewed with suspicion and treated properly.

2.5-Fluorouracil-induced leukoencephalopathy in patients with breast cancer.
Sung Min CHOI ; Seung Han LEE ; Yong Seok YANG ; Byeong Chae KIM ; Myeong Kyu KIM ; Ki Hyun CHO
Journal of Korean Medical Science 2001;16(3):328-334
The purpose of this study is to determine the characteristic clinical features, radiologic findings, and precipitating and prognostic factors in the patients with breast cancer and with 5-Fluorouracil (5-FU)-induced leukoencephalopathy. We reviewed the medical records of six breast cancer patients who developed leukoencephalopathy after chemotherapy which included 5-FU and also evaluated thorough neurological examinations including mini-mental status examination, cerebrospinal fluid studies, brain images and brain biopsies. Six patients exhibited slowly progressing neurologic symptoms characterized by the impairment of cognitive function, abulia, ataxic gait, and/or akinetic mutism. None of the patients had any specific causes or etiologic factors for leukoencephalopathy. Brain MRI in all patients showed diffuse periventricular white matter changes in the T2-weighted MR image. Brain biopsy in Patient 1 showed fragmented axonal fiber and minimally deprived myelination with many scattered macrophages. Five patients who treated with steroids at the onset of neurological symptoms showed clinical improvement, regardless of their age, sex, the pathology and stage of breast cancer, or the total dosage of chemotherapeutic agents. We conclude that leukoencephalopathy in these cases could be attributable to 5-FU neurotoxicity and suggest that the administration of steroids might be the treatment of choice.
